Output e434e1ea36d8f98e9daa10821c75b34daf372e53a4e3c708528a2322c9446593:1

value
14422871
script pubkey
OP_0 OP_PUSHBYTES_32 3d2f9bb15081768ca9f140ccf0205c4bc6d778654da22a8b8dfd46de3313c495
address
bc1q85hehv2ss9mge203grx0qgzuf0rdw7r9fk3z4zudl4rduvcncj2sqx04v2
transaction
e434e1ea36d8f98e9daa10821c75b34daf372e53a4e3c708528a2322c9446593
confirmations
215623
spent
true